These can appear in one or both eyes and may last up to 20 minutes. This type … WebAug 27, 2024 · Usually, spider webs in your vision are the result of posterior vitreous detachment. The bulk of the eye is made up of the vitreous body, which is comprised of a jelly-like substance. If the vitreous body pulls away from the retina, the jelly may form strands or shapes. As those strands shift, they cast shadows on the retina, creating a … WebAnswer What you are seeing in front of your eyes are something called 'floaters.' WebMar 12, 2024 · Black spots in vision, also known as floaters, are the specks, squiggly lines, or cobwebs you may notice in your line of sight. Floaters are clumps of the gel-like vitreous humor that fills your eye. These are very common, and while potentially annoying, they are usually not a cause for concern. WebDespite the name, they do in fact sink slowly, so they tend to collect near the centre of your field of view when you lie on your back. In fact, it's only because they move that you can see them at all. If they were fixed, your brain would soon learn to tune them out completely.
